Output 8046c28825f8f06c1007c2cf4d4b93fd556ab65de68fa1648cc9afc23e1cde94:14

value
100248363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ce493aaccc4bac120881f4a0aa0b56b2c415071 OP_EQUAL
address
MEujQog33umhwXYvpH5UdAsRERznPHxBXe
transaction
8046c28825f8f06c1007c2cf4d4b93fd556ab65de68fa1648cc9afc23e1cde94
spent
true